Directorate of Revenue Intelligence (DRI) officials today arrested two persons along with 515 kg ganja (marijuana) worth Rs 1.65 crore in the international market in the wee hours of the day in Patna district.

Acting on a tip off, DRI officials said a truck was intercepted in Mokama town in the wee hours and the consignment of ganja was found kept hidden in the hood of the truck, which was coming from Tripura.

The value of the seized contraband is estimated to be around Rs 35 lakh in domestic market, while its value in international market will be around Rs 1.65 crore, the officials said.

The two arrested in this connection have been identified as Tuntun Kumar and Ajeet Kumar, both residents of Bihar, officials said adding, the truck has been seized.
